Research and Markets has added the "Commercial Applications for


Photocatalytic Nanoparticle Titania" report to their catalogue.
Commercializing nanocrystalline photocatalytic materials will lead
to advancement and progress in the field of nanomaterials.
The nanocrystalline materials demonstrate special chemical and physical properties, which prove useful for a wide variety of
applications. Currently, nanoparticles of titanium dioxide (TiO2) can be used for industrial purposes and holds promise of releasing
innovative products in the future.
The photocatalytic phenomena of nanomaterials can be used in numerous applications including anti-fogging car mirrors, selfcleaning windows, tiles and textiles and anti-microbial coatings. Nanoscale TiO2 coatings can be used commercially for applications
in architectural, medical, food, automotive industries, environmental protection, textile and glass industry.
The report covers details on topics such as the global market for photocatalytic products, the global market for TiO2 and the
limitations of nanoparticle-based titanium dioxide for photocatalysts.
